Lamata Cenizo Durango
Durango cenizo at 50% – Lamata's house northern workhorse
Score: 3.5/5 agaves
- Producer: Lamata
- Region: El Mezquital, Durango
- Agave: Cenizo
- ABV: 50%
- Price: $92 ($$$)
Verdict
Lamata Cenizo Durango is a strong northern-cenizo reference, the 50% proof carries the mesquite character without pushing into harshness, and the price is reasonable for the quality. Lagrimas de Dolores Joven drinks similarly; pick by availability. Raters have it at 3.9, and we're on board.
Lamata's cenizo is northern mezcal's workhorse argument at 50%
Tasting notes
Nose: Mesquite, cooked cenizo, mineral, desert herb
Palate: Dry and iron-tinged at 50%. Lamata's Durango cenizo is in direct competition with Lagrimas de Dolores Joven; the proof is higher, the character similar, and the production choices consistent with the brand's general philosophy
Finish: Mesquite-wet slate, cool close – long
The bottom line
The 50% carries the mesquite cleanly. Reliable Durango cenizo at destination proof
